Often Asked Questions

What is a gas safety check?

A gas safety check is an evaluation of gas devices, flues, and pipework in a property to guarantee they are safe to utilize and meet the required legal requirements.

Why do I need a gas safety check?

Gas safety checks are vital to guarantee the safety of everybody in the property. Defective gas appliances can trigger gas leakages, fires, explosions, and carbon monoxide gas poisoning.

How frequently should I have a gas safety check?

Gas safety checks need to be performed each year by a Gas Safe signed up engineer to ensure the ongoing safety of your gas devices.

What does a gas safety check include?

A gas safety check includes inspecting gas devices for proper performance, looking for gas leakages, ensuring appropriate ventilation, and checking the flue and pipework for any problems.

Can I carry out a gas safety check myself?

No, gas safety checks ought to only be carried out by a qualified Gas Safe registered engineer who has the needed competence and devices to carry out a thorough evaluation.

How long does a gas safety check take?

The duration of a gas safety check can differ depending on the variety of devices to be checked, but it typically takes around 30 minutes to an hour.

What occurs if my gas safety check fails?

If a gas safety check stops working, the engineer will encourage you on the required repairs or actions needed to make the appliances safe. They will not leave the home in a hazardous condition.

How much does a gas safety check expense in Newport Pagnell?

The expense of a gas safety check can vary depending upon the variety of home appliances to be inspected and any required repairs. It is best to get in touch with a Gas Safe registered engineer for a quote.

Is a gas safety check the exact same as a boiler service?

No, a gas safety check is focused on ensuring the safety of gas home appliances, flues, and pipework, whereas a boiler service consists of cleansing and keeping the boiler to ensure it is functioning efficiently.

Are landlords needed to have gas safety checks for their homes?

Yes, landlords are legally bound to have annual gas safety checks performed by a Gas Safe signed up engineer and supply renters with a Gas Safety Record.
